What is the Customer Journey?

The process a customer goes through when interacting with a business, from the initial discovery of a solution to the final purchase.

The customer journey describes the complete lifecycle of a customer's interactions and experiences with a brand or business. It encompasses every touchpoint, from the initial awareness or discovery of the brand all the way through to purchase, usage, and even advocacy or referral. Essentially, the customer journey provides a holistic view of how customers perceive, interact with, and feel about a business or product over time.

Importance of Customer Journey

  • Holistic View: Understanding the customer journey provides businesses with a comprehensive look at the customer experience, highlighting strengths and identifying pain points.
  • Informed Decision Making: By examining how customers move through different stages, businesses can make more informed decisions on marketing, sales, and support strategies.
  • Enhanced Personalization: Recognizing the various touchpoints and stages enables businesses, especially SaaS companies, to personalize interactions, making them more relevant and engaging.
  • Improved Retention: By addressing bottlenecks or friction points in the journey, companies can enhance satisfaction and loyalty.
  • Resource Allocation: Insights from the customer journey help allocate resources more effectively, targeting areas that matter most to customers.

Stages of the Customer Journey

  1. Awareness: The potential customer becomes aware of the brand, product, or service, often through marketing efforts, word-of-mouth, or organic search.
  2. Consideration: Customers research, compare, and deliberate about the offerings, weighing the pros and cons.
  3. Decision/Purchase: The stage where the customer commits to the product or service.
  4. Usage/Experience: The customer uses the product or service and forms perceptions about its quality, relevance, and value.
  5. Loyalty & Advocacy: Satisfied customers return for repeat purchases and may also advocate for the brand, referring new potential customers.

Mapping the Customer Journey

  1. Identify Touchpoints: List all the points of interaction a customer has with your brand – from websites and ads to customer service calls.
  2. Understand Customer Goals: For each touchpoint, determine what the customer is trying to achieve.
  3. Gather Data: Use surveys, analytics, and feedback to understand how customers feel at each touchpoint.
  4. Visual Representation: Create a visual map of the journey, highlighting stages, touchpoints, and emotions or experiences associated with each.
  5. Iterate: Regularly revisit and update the journey map as customer behaviors, technologies, or business offerings change.

Strategies to Enhance the Customer Journey

  1. Personalized Content: Tailor content to the specific stage of the journey, ensuring it's relevant and helpful.
  2. Feedback Loops: Actively seek and act upon customer feedback to improve touchpoints.
  3. Unified Communications: Ensure consistency in messaging and brand voice across all touchpoints.
  4. User-friendly Interfaces: For digital businesses and SaaS platforms, an intuitive, user-friendly interface can enhance the customer's experience.
  5. Proactive Support: Anticipate potential issues or questions and provide proactive solutions or guidance.
